Russia increased electricity export to Mongolia by 100 MW-official

Russia’s electricity export to Mongolia and China will grow by 19-20% annually to 5.2 bln kWh

MOSCOW, November 15. /TASS/. Russia has increased the capacity of electricity export supplies to Mongolia by 100 MW, Deputy Prime Minister Viktoria Abramchenko told reporters after the meeting of the Russian-Mongolian intergovernmental commission.

"We agreed with the Mongolian partners to scale up electricity supplies to the Mongolian market and increased such deliveries by 100 MW," she said.

Russia’s electricity export to Mongolia and China will grow by 19-20% annually to 5.2 bln kWh, Energy Minister Nikolay Shulginov said earlier.
